On Thu, Feb 05, 2026 at 11:29:04AM +0000, Lorenzo Stoakes wrote:
> We either need a wrapper that eliminates this parameter (but then we're adding a
> wrapper to this behaviour that is literally for one driver that is _temporarily_
> being modularised which is weak justifiction), or use of a function that invokes
> it that is currently exported.
I have not talked with distros about it, but quite a few of them enable
Binder because one or two applications want to use Binder to emulate
Android. I imagine that even if Android itself goes back to built-in,
distros would want it as a module so that you don't have to load it for
every user, rather than for the few users that want to use waydroid or
similar.
A few examples:
